In your front-page story, “Beach alcohol ban to get 1-year trial,” (Beacon, Nov. 8), you reported that District 4 Councilman Tony Young “offered no explanation for his no vote” when the City Council approved a one-year alcohol ban at city beaches, bay shores and coastal parks on Nov. 5.”
Actually, Councilman Young would have been hard-pressed to explain why he voted against the aforementioned alcohol ban in view of the fact that his own council district is flush with a total of 26 alcohol-free public parks.
Furthermore, from among the eight city council districts, only one has more alcohol-free public parks than Council District 4.
The ban on alcohol at city beaches, bay shores and coastal parks will come up for a second reading within the next couple of weeks.
Councilman Tony Young will likely vote no again ” as well as offer no explanation for the hypocrisy of his opposition to alcohol-free public parks in Pacific Beach, Mission Beach and Ocean Beach.
